Notes:
1. The maximum cable length for the signal extension link between the transmitter and receiver is
230 feet (70 meters) using Crestron DM-CBL-8G DigitalMedia 8G cable or third-party CAT5e
(or better). Shielded cable and connectors are recommended to safeguard against
unpredictable environmental electrical noise. All wire and cables are sold separately. The signal
extension link is a proprietary interface and is not compatible with HDBaseT
®
, DigitalMedia
(DM
®
), Ethernet, or any other CATx based interface.
2. Each HDMI input requires an appropriate adapter or interface cable to accommodate a DVI or
Dual-Mode DisplayPort signal. CBL-HD-DVI interface cables are available separately.
3. The VGA input can accept RGB and component video signals through an appropriate adapter
(not included).
4. The analog audio input currently works exclusively with the VGA video input. The ability to
pair the analog audio input with an HDMI video input will be enabled through a future
firmware update.
5. The HDMI output requires an appropriate adapter or interface cable to accommodate a DVI
signal. CBL-HD-DVI interface cables are available separately.
6. The analog stereo audio output is only active when the input is receiving a 2-channel stereo
signal via either the analog input or HDMI.
7. EDID (Extended Display Identification Data) is data embedded in an HDMI, DVI, or VGA signal
that enables the display device to tell the scaler what resolutions and formats it can support,
allowing the scaler to configure itself automatically to feed an optimal output signal to
the display.
8. IR control capability will be enabled through a future firmware update.
9. Item(s) sold separately.
10. Supports any input resolution and scan rate that has a pixel clock of 165 MHz or lower.
11. With or without reduced blanking.
12. With reduced blanking only.
13. The transmitter and receiver are powered together by a single wall mount power pack
(included), which may be connected to either the transmitter or receiver, not both.
